To help your baby who jumps in their sleep and wakes up frequently during the night, try creating a calming bedtime routine, ensuring a comfortable sleep environment, and providing gentle soothing techniques when they wake up. Consulting with a pediatrician can also help identify any underlying issues causing the sleep disturbances.

Why does my 5-month-old wake up so frequently during the night?

A 5-month-old may wake up frequently during the night due to their developing sleep patterns, hunger, discomfort, or a need for reassurance. It is common for infants to wake up multiple times during the night at this age as they are still adjusting to longer periods of sleep.
